Kedah Rubber City set to generate jobs, boost economy


Future forward: Ismail Sabri (centre) with (from left) Mahdzir, Mustapa, Muhammad Sanusi and NCIA chief executive Datuk Seri Jebasingam Issace John at the launch of Kedah Rubber City in Padang Terap, Kuala Nerang. — CHAN BOON KAI/The Star

ALOR SETAR: The newly launched Kedah Rubber City (KRC) project is expected to generate some 15,000 employment opportunities for Malaysians and attract RM10bil worth of investment by 2025, says the Prime Minister.

Datuk Seri Ismail Sabri Yaakob said the project had already attracted RM4bil in investments even though it had just been officially launched.
